Ladislav Michnovi=C4=8D wrote: > 2006/4/7, Jon Keating <jo...@li...>: >=20 >>On Wed, March 29, 2006 4:42 am, Martin Garbe wrote: >> >>>ok. I looked at rfc 1738. there the url is denfined. In this rfc s= ome >>>groups of characters are explained. >>> >>>- - alphanumeric >>>- - unsafe characters: <>"#%{}|\^~[]` space >>>- - reserved characters: ;/?:@=3D& >>>- - special characters: $-_.+!*'(), >>> >>>All these characters can be part of an url. >>>I now include all these characters except: <>" space >>>Please try the patch now. >> >>I have included this patch in SVN and hopefully it will get a thour= ough >>testing by the users to see if it is lacking anything. >=20 >=20 > Hello. I have a experience that URL: > http://suseportal.cz/node/1489#comment-3263 > is truncated after #. In the attachend patch # is added to the regular expression. regards rsLeo |
